A'ja Wilson Secures Record-Breaking Supermax Deal with Las Vegas Aces

A'ja Wilson, a celebrated figure in the WNBA and a four-time MVP, recently made headlines by signing a groundbreaking contract with the Las Vegas Aces, even without stepping onto the court. This significant development highlights her continued influence and value within the league and to her team.

Reports confirm that Wilson has recommitted to the Las Vegas Aces through a new agreement. While specific financial terms were not officially disclosed by the Aces, sources like ESPN have indicated that the deal is a three-year, fully guaranteed supermax contract valued at $5 million. This landmark agreement represents the most substantial contract ever awarded in the history of the WNBA, marking a new era for player compensation in women's professional basketball.

Aces president and general manager, Vikki Fargas, lauded Wilson's unparalleled contributions, describing her as a singular talent who has been instrumental in the franchise's current achievements. Fargas emphasized Wilson's consistent record-breaking performances, coupled with her exemplary confidence, authenticity, and grace, expressing eagerness to witness her continued excellence in an Aces uniform. Wilson, drafted first overall by the Aces in 2018, has been a cornerstone of the team's success, guiding them to three championships in the past four seasons. Her impressive statistics from the last season, averaging 23.4 points, 10.2 rebounds, 3.1 assists, 2.3 blocks, and 1.6 steals in 40 games, culminated in her receiving a fourth MVP trophy. Throughout her distinguished career, the 29-year-old, a seven-time All-Star and three-time Defensive Player of the Year, has maintained remarkable career averages of 21.4 points, 9.3 rebounds, 2.3 assists, 2.0 blocks, and 1.3 steals over 267 games, nearly all of which she started.
